Charles Joseph Tyson was born in 1897 in Louth, Lincolnshire, England, the child of Charles Joseph Tyson And Cathern Tyson. In 1901, Charles Joseph Tyson resided in Grainthorpe, Grainthorpe, Lincolnshire, England. In 1911, Charles Joseph Tyson resided in Bradley, Scartho and Weelsby, Lincolnshire, Englan. Charles Joseph Tyson married Violet Louisa Maria Sear, and had children including Brian C Tyson. Charles Joseph Tyson passed away in 1972 in Pontefract, Yorkshire West Riding, England.
